New oral migraine prevention drug approved by FDA
Posted in Medicine on 24th Dec, 2019
by Alex Muller
Continuing the wave of cutting-edge new migraine drugs reaching the American market, the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) has now approved the first oral calcitonin gene-related peptide (CGRP) antagonist for acute migraine treatment.
